在Debian环境下,环境变量的安全性是一个重要的话题。环境变量通常用于存储系统配置信息,如路径、用户名、密码等敏感数据。如果这些信息被不当处理或泄露,可能会导致安全风险。以下是一些关于Debian环境下环境变量安全性的探讨:
/etc/environment文件中设置,对所有用户生效。~/.bashrc、~/.profile或~/.bash_profile文件中设置。gpg)来加密这些信息,并在需要时解密。sudo来实现。pass、HashiCorp Vault等,可以帮助管理和加密敏感信息。Lynis进行系统安全扫描,检查潜在的安全问题。以下是一个简单的示例,展示如何在Debian环境下安全地设置和使用环境变量:
# 在用户的.bashrc文件中设置环境变量 export MY_SECRET_KEY=$(gpg --decrypt /path/to/encrypted/key.gpg) # 在脚本中使用环境变量 #!/bin/bash echo "The secret key is: $MY_SECRET_KEY" 通过以上措施,可以在Debian环境下提高环境变量的安全性,减少潜在的安全风险。